Output adabebb2a23620df26badf198a6c847af0fe2625e01342628762f53412575604:4

value
66871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90fc8a4bb7e8c06e3516ce29ae1fbcee7541e9af OP_EQUAL
address
3EudkyAwP4q9oFkU6jhkahisAHe6TU29X3
transaction
adabebb2a23620df26badf198a6c847af0fe2625e01342628762f53412575604
spent
true